Trump Media and Technology Group Corp vs FirstEnergy Corp. — how do they compare? Trump Media and Technology Group Corp trades at $9.01 (market cap $2.50B), while FirstEnergy Corp. trades at $49.5 (market cap $28.01B). The key difference: FirstEnergy Corp. is far larger — about 11.2× Trump Media and Technology Group Corp's market cap, and FirstEnergy Corp. pays a 3.84% dividend while Trump Media and Technology Group Corp pays none. Trump Media and Technology Group Corp

DJT trades at $8.52, down 0.23% today, with a bullish technical signal from moving averages but neutral oscillators. The company reported minimal revenue of $3.68M in 2025 alongside a massive net loss of -$712.06M, reflecting severe profitability challenges. Recent news highlights a nearly 50% stock decline in 2026 and the cancellation of a Truth Social spin-off, while a merger with TAE Technologies aims to pivot toward nuclear fusion energy.

The outlook remains highly speculative, with the stock's meme-driven volatility and fundamental weaknesses posing significant risks. Investment opportunity hinges on successful execution of the TAE merger and fusion technology prospects, but persistent losses and high valuation ratios suggest substantial downside potential if growth fails to materialize.

FirstEnergy Corp.

FirstEnergy Corp. (FE) trades at $48.43, up 1.06% on the day, with a bullish technical signal supported by moving averages. The stock shows steady revenue growth, reaching $15.09B in 2025, and maintains a net income margin of 6.86%. Analyst consensus is a Buy with a $52.00 price target, reflecting optimism around grid investments and data center demand. Recent news highlights FE's strategic positioning amid rising energy needs and infrastructure upgrades.

Outlook is positive due to strong fundamentals and growth initiatives, but risks include high debt levels and regulatory pressures. The stock offers potential upside from current levels, supported by earnings beats and institutional confidence, though investors should monitor cash flow trends and execution of capital expenditures.

About Trump Media and Technology Group Corp

Trump Media & Technology Group is a media firm rooted in social media and digital streaming. Its flagship product, Truth Social, provides a platform focused on free speech and open conversation.

About FirstEnergy Corp.

FirstEnergy is one of the largest investor-owned utilities in the United States with 10 regulated distribution companies across six mid-Atlantic and Midwestern states. FirstEnergy also owns and operates one of the nation's largest electric transmission systems with 24,000 miles of lines.
